כיוונים

פיתוח אפליקציות: כל מה שצריך לדעת

בעולם הדיגיטלי של היום, מי לא חלם ליצור את האפליקציה הגדולה הבאה? אולי חשבתם על רעיון לאפליקציה לנייד שיכולה לחולל מהפכה בשגרת היום-יום או אפילו לשנות את הדרך שבה אנו מתקשרים. אבל איך המחשבה החולפת הזאת הופכת לאפליקציה מוחשית ומתפקדת? אם אי פעם הרהרתם בשאלה הזו, או אם אתם יושבים כרגע על רעיון שעשוי להיות פורץ דרך אבל לא בטוחים לגבי הצעדים הבאים, אתם במקום הנכון. במדריך זה נסביר כיצד להפוך את הרעיון שלכם מקונספט גרידא לאפליקציה מתפקדת ונסייע לכם להפוך את החזון הדיגיטלי שלכם למציאות.

  1. המשגה רעיונית

  • זיהוי הצורך: השלב הראשון בכל תהליך פיתוח אפליקציה הוא לזהות צורך או בעיה ספציפיים שהאפליקציה שואפת לפתור. זה יכול לנוע בין מילוי פער בשוק, שיפור פתרון קיים, המצאה טכנולוגית לעסקים או אפילו להציע בידור.
  • אימות הרעיון: ברגע שמזהים את הצורך, חיוני לאמת את הרעיון. זה כרוך בסקר שוק, זיהוי מתחרים פוטנציאליים וקביעת נקודת המכירה הייחודית (USP) של האפליקציה שלכם. אפשר גם לערוך סקרים או ראיונות עם משתמשים פוטנציאליים כדי לחדד את הרעיון עוד יותר.
  1. תכנון ועיצוב

  • שרטוט בסיסי: התחילו בשרטוט בסיסי של האפליקציה שלכם. זה לא חייב להיות משהו דיגיטלי, אפילו סקיצות עיפרון פשוטות על נייר יכולות להיות יעילות. שלב זה עוזר להציג באופן חזותי את זרימת האפליקציה ואת ממשק המשתמש (UI) שלה.
  • עיצוב ממשק המשתמש/חוויית המשתמש: מתוך מחשבה על מבנה בסיסי, עברו לשלב העיצוב. ממשק המשתמש (UI) מגדיר כיצד האפליקציה שלכם נראית, בעוד שחוויית המשתמש (UX) קובעת כיצד היא מרגישה למשתמש. מעצבים מקצועיים יכולים לעזור להבטיח שהאפליקציה תהיה גם אסתטית וגם ידידותית למשתמש.
  1. שיקולים טכניים

  • בחירת פלטפורמה: האם האפליקציה שלכם תהיה זמינה עבור iOS, Android או שניהם? להחלטה זו יהיו השלכות על תהליך הפיתוח. חלק מהאפליקציות הן מקוריות, שנבנו במיוחד עבור פלטפורמה אחת, בעוד שאחרות הן חוצות פלטפורמות, שנועדו לפעול במערכות הפעלה מרובות. אם אינכם בטוחים איזו לבחור, תוכלו להיכנס לאתר https://wedev.co.il/ ולהתייעץ עם המומחים ואף לשכור את שירותיהם בפיתוח התוכנה שלכם.
  • בחירת הטכנולוגיה הנכונה: בהתאם לצורכי האפליקציה שלכם ולפלטפורמה שנבחרה, יהיה עליכם לבחור את הטכנולוגיה המתאימה. זה יכול לכלול שפות תכנות, מסגרות וכלים.

 

 

  1. פיתוח אפליקציות

  • הגדרת סביבת הפיתוח: לפני תחילת כתיבת הקידוד, יהיה עליכם להגדיר סביבת פיתוח מתאימה. זה כרוך בהתקנת התוכנות, הכלים והספריות הדרושים לפלטפורמה ולטכנולוגיה שנבחרו.
  • קידוד האפליקציה: זהו השלב שבו האפליקציה בנויה בפועל. בהתאם למורכבות האפליקציה, שלב זה עשוי להימשך בין שבועות לחודשים. חיוני לעקוב אחר שיטות עבודה מומלצות ולשמור על בסיס קוד נקי.
  1. בדיקה

  • בדיקת יחידות: זוהי שיטה שבה נבדקות יחידות או רכיבים בודדים של האפליקציה כדי לוודא שהם פועלים כמתוכנן. זה עוזר לתפוס בעיות בשלב מוקדם במחזור הפיתוח.
  • בדיקת אינטגרציה: לאחר בדיקת יחידות בודדות, הן משולבות ונבחנות כקבוצה. זה מבטיח שהיחידות יפעלו יחד בצורה חלקה.
  • בדיקות בטא: לפני ההשקה המלאה של האפליקציה, כדאי שקבוצת משתמשים תבדוק אותה בתנאי אמת. המשוב שלהם יכול לעזור לזהות באגים של הרגע האחרון או בעיות בשימוש.
  1. פריסה

  • הכנה להפעלה: לפני ההפעלה, ודאו שכל רכיבי האפליקציה, כולל גרפיקה, תיאורים וקישורי תמיכה, מוכנים לחנות האפליקציות לבחירתכם.
  • שליחה לחנות האפליקציות: ברגע שהכול מוכן, תוכלו לשלוח את האפליקציה שלכם לפלטפורמות כמו Apple App Store או Google Play. חשוב להיות מודעים לכך שלפלטפורמות אלה יש הנחיות וסטנדרטים ספציפיים. האפליקציה חייבת לעמוד בדרישות אלה כדי לקבל אישור.
  • ניטור ועדכונים לאחר ההפעלה: לאחר שהאפליקציה שלכם תהיה פעילה, העבודה לא תסתיים. ניטור ביצועי האפליקציה, איסוף משוב מהמשתמשים ושחרור עדכונים שוטפים הם קריטיים לאריכות ימים ולהצלחה של האפליקציה.

לסיכום

היציאה לתהליך הפיתוח מרעיון לאפליקציה ליישום שלה בעולם האמיתי יכולה להיראות מסובכת בעולם דיגיטלי עצום. עם זאת, על ידי פירוק קפדני של התהליך לשלבים ספציפיים ומובנים, הדרך הופכת ברורה יותר וניתנת להשגה. כל שלב, החל מההמשגה הראשונית ועד לניטור שלאחר ההשקה, הוא עדות ליכולת היצירתית והטכנית הנדרשת בעולם פיתוח האפליקציות של ימינו. זכרו, מאחורי כל אפליקציה פורצת דרך מסתתר סיפור של נחישות, חדשנות ותשוקה. לכן, החזיקו ברעיון הזה שלכם, אמצו את התהליך וראו כיצד מחשבה פשוטה יכולה להתפתח ליישום שרבים מוקירים.

גלילה לראש העמוד